This treatment utilizes a specialized table to assist chiropractors in delicately stretching and maneuvering the spine while applying gentle pressure. By employing a specialized table, chiropractors can stabilize specific areas of the spine, facilitating pain-free and effective adjustments. This non-forceful treatment aids the spine in its healing process, ultimately reducing pain.
